Tony Khan Says Dual AEW Dynamite/Collision Tapings Will Not Be A Regular Occurrence

Tony Khan

AEW CEO Tony Khan took part in the Full Gear media conference call, where he discussed a wide range of topics.

During the interview, Khan discussed the increase of dual AEW Dynamite and Collision TV tapings in 2025.

“It’s a low percentage and it’s not supposed to be a common thing at all, and it’s not going to be a regular occurrence. Rarely are we taping the shows on the same night. The only time you really see it happen more than once consecutively is around the Australia event, which is a little bit of a different cadence for us because we have to film content and then fly the crew internationally. It’s not going to be common and very rarely would be tape those shows on the same night. Typically, it’s around an international trip or a special occurrence. The cadence of tapings is far from final for next year. There are still great media opportunities out there for AEW and we’re still having a lot of active negotiations about AEW and Ring of Honor.”
